Greece: Community Project for “Authentic Natural Food”

“Hippocrates believed food was the human's medicine. Today, food is the reason that people need medicine”. That's what Radiki (‘Chicory’ in Greek) states, a small community project in Raches village [el] in Messenia, Peloponnese. In their website, they argue that people should return to authentic food forms, as they have become too addicted to artificial mass product tastes. The community cultivates only with local traditional Messenian seeds and their products include wild greens, olive oil, trachanas (traditional Greek pasta) and sundried fruits.
